Group Stage: The Opening Act

Thirty-two teams are divided into 8 groups of 4. Each team plays 6 matches (home and away). The top 2 from each group advance to the Round of 16. Points system: 3 for a win, 1 for a draw, 0 for a loss. Simple, na?

Knockout Phase: Where Legends Are Made

From the Round of 16 to the final, it’s a two-legged affair (except the final). Away goals rule? Scrapped from 2021–22. Now it’s pure, unfiltered football — extra time and penalties if needed. The drama is next-level. 🔥

2005: The Miracle of Istanbul

Liverpool vs AC Milan. 3–0 down at half-time. What happened next? Six minutes of madness — Gerrard, Smicer, Alonso — and the Reds lifted the trophy. 2014: La Décima for Real Madrid

Real Madrid’s 10th European title — La Décima — came after a 12-year wait. Sergio Ramos’s 93rd-minute header forced extra time, and Real crushed Atlético 4–1. Since then, Los Blancos have become the kings of the competition with 14 titles. 👑

From 4–4–2 to 3–4–3: The Formation Wars

In the 2000s, 4–4–2 was king. Then came 4–3–3 (Barcelona’s tiki-taka), 3–4–3 (Conte’s Chelsea), and 4–2–3–1 (the modern default). Guardiola, Klopp, Ancelotti — each manager brought a philosophy. Indian fans love debating: “Sachin, 4–3–3 is good, but gegenpressing is next level, yaar!”

Gegenpressing: The Klopp Revolution

Jürgen Klopp’s gegenpressing — pressing immediately after losing the ball — turned Liverpool into a monster. In 2018–19, they won the UCL with a high-intensity style that left opponents breathless. For tactical nerds, it was a dream. For neutrals, it was entertainment gold.

The Rise of the False 9

Lionel Messi under Pep Guardiola redefined the false 9 role — dropping deep, dragging defenders out of position, and creating chaos. Today, players like Kai Havertz and Roberto Firmino have carried that torch. Tactical flexibility is now a must in the Uefa Champion League.
